+Solution9 Posted March 1, 2016 Share Posted March 1, 2016 Ok I'm having a miserable time trying to figure out how to set up pocket queries, and download them to my gps. There are gpx files in there that are not even close to where I am. How do I get those removed? What program do I need to move the pocket queries to? Nothing is making much sense. Can someone explain this Barney style? Quote Link to comment
+Pinballwiz Posted March 2, 2016 Share Posted March 2, 2016 Plug your GPS into your computer. Wait until Windows asks about mass storage. Open up the folder. If you have a microSD card, then open that one. If you don't then just open the Garmin folder. Look for the .gpx file. Delete it. Go back to the website and run the correct pocket query this time for your location. Hit download or generate. Then, click on the file and drag it over to the previous folder where you deleted the other .gpx files. Safely disconnect the mass storage drive (your GPS). Then, turn it on. You'll be good to go.
